Transaction 633cbf2c685236d25953959da740cf344cea8995c4ce8e6e89f07ced3d7e2f21
1 Input
1 Output
-
633cbf2c685236d25953959da740cf344cea8995c4ce8e6e89f07ced3d7e2f21:0
- value
- 1426660
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ef01dda59cd125e96419bb9c7e08fbc547417c9 OP_EQUAL
- address
- 3BobuEs8McghLDSU2n6hAKpEz8jbZ6pHbU